Overview

Julia is an attorney in the San Diego office who advises employers on a range of workplace matters. She represents clients in matters involving the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A); Title VII discrimination, retaliation, and harassment; the Family and Medical Leave Act (FMLA); the Age Discrimination in Employment Act (ADEA); wrongful termination; and wage and hour laws.

Julia graduated Order of the Coif and magna cum laude from the University of San Diego School of Law. While at USD Law, she was a member of the San Diego Law Review and served as the Lead Articles Editor. Julia was inducted into the International Legal Honor Society of Phi Delta Phi and was a research assistant for Vice Dean and Professor of Law, Margaret Dalton, focusing on special education law. In addition, she received the CALI award in Federal Courts. 

During law school, Julia externed for the Honorable Janis L. Sammartino and the Honorable Michael M. Anello in the U.S. District Court for the Southern District of California.

Julia received her B.A. in English and Philosophy, graduating Phi Beta Kappa and summa cum laude from the University of San Diego, where she was also a member of the Division I Women’s Soccer team.
